Why 16 Inch Shelving Brackets Is Necessary

I find 16 inch shelving brackets necessary because they give my shelves the support they need for everyday use. When I use brackets that match standard stud spacing, I feel much more confident that the shelf is secure and less likely to sag over time. That extra stability matters to me, especially when I want to store books, decor, kitchen items, or other heavier things.

My experience has also shown me that 16 inch shelving brackets make installation much easier and more reliable. Since many wall studs are spaced 16 inches apart, these brackets often line up well with the structure of the wall. That means I can anchor my shelves more firmly, which helps improve safety and durability.

I also like that 16 inch shelving brackets help me create a cleaner, more organized space. With strong support in place, I can use my shelves confidently without worrying about them bending or failing. For me, that makes them a practical choice for both function and peace of mind.

My Buying Guides on 16 Inch Shelving Brackets

Why I Pay Attention to 16 Inch Shelving Brackets

When I shop for shelving brackets, I look closely at the 16-inch size because it is one of the most practical options for standard shelves. In my experience, this length usually offers a good balance of support and versatility, especially for books, décor, kitchen items, or garage storage. I find that choosing the right bracket makes a big difference in both safety and appearance.

Check the Weight Capacity First

The first thing I always check is how much weight the bracket can hold. Not all 16-inch shelving brackets are built the same, and I have learned that a shelf can fail if the bracket is too weak for the load. If I plan to store heavy items, I look for heavy-duty steel brackets with a high weight rating and pair them with a strong shelf board.

Choose the Right Material

In my experience, material matters a lot. Steel brackets are usually my first choice because they feel sturdy and reliable. If I want a more decorative look, I may consider brackets with a coated finish or a style that matches the room. For damp areas, I prefer rust-resistant finishes so the brackets last longer.

Match the Bracket Style to My Space

I also think about how the bracket will look in the room. Some 16-inch shelving brackets are simple and hidden, while others are decorative and meant to be seen. If I want a clean modern look, I choose a minimal design. If I want the shelf to stand out, I may pick a more decorative bracket style.

Make Sure the Size Fits My Shelf

I always confirm that the 16-inch bracket matches the depth of my shelf board. The bracket should support the shelf properly without sticking out awkwardly or leaving too much overhang. I also check the shelf thickness and make sure the bracket and mounting hardware are compatible.

Look at the Wall Type Before Buying

One thing I have learned is that the wall type affects installation a lot. Drywall, wood studs, brick, and concrete all need different anchors or screws. Before I buy, I think about where I will install the shelf so I can choose brackets and hardware that will actually hold securely.

Think About Installation Ease

I prefer brackets that are easy to install, especially if I am doing the project myself. Some come with mounting hardware and clear instructions, which saves me time and frustration. I also look for brackets with pre-drilled holes, because that usually makes alignment easier.

Consider Indoor or Outdoor Use

If I am using the brackets outdoors, I make sure they are made for that purpose. Outdoor brackets need weather-resistant finishes to handle moisture and temperature changes. For indoor spaces, I usually have more flexibility, but I still like durable coatings that prevent wear.

Balance Function and Appearance

For me, the best 16-inch shelving bracket is one that works well and looks good too. I do not want to sacrifice strength for style, but I also do not want a bracket that looks out of place. I try to choose a design that supports the shelf properly while blending into the room’s overall look.
